Job Description Job Description We are looking for a drafter who is organized, detail-oriented, efficient, and experienced in industrial automation electrical control systems to help us support our team and customers. Automation Solutions creates innovative custom machine control solutions. During the past 25+ years, we have provided industrial automation systems, machines, services and components to machine builders and end-users throughout the world.
We occupy a unique niche as both a Factory Authorized Systems Integrator and an Authorized Distributor for many quality automation lines.
- Create accurate, detailed electrical schematic and layouts drawings based on sketches and instructions provided by our engineering team.
- Ensure continuity of design and documentation by ensuring as-built changes are captured on both the drawings and BOMs.
- Be the librarian of our technical documentation and maintain the organization of it to support the rest of the teams.
- Provide excellent customer service while providing our customers with drawings and documentation.
- Be a positive team member while managing multiple projects and meeting deadlines.
- Thorough familiarity with industrial control components and terminology.
- Fluent in ANSI Y32.2/IEEE and IEC electrical schematic symbols and layouts.
- Willing to embrace Automation Solutions drafting standards and practices.
- AS degree in drafting or equivalent experience.
- Proficiency in 2D Auto Cad (Draft Sight).
- Functional understanding of UL508A and NFPA
79 standards. - 5+ Years of experience. (Flexible for the right candidate)
- Detail-oriented and dedicated to quality.
- Demonstrate good presence, professionalism, and congeniality.
- Seek and adhere to best practices.
- Willing to rework multiple times if needed and learn from mistakes.
- Eager to learn new technology, techniques and optimize both products and procedures.
- Able to work independently and to be part of an effective team.
- Work occasional overtime as needed.
- Excellent problem-solving and critical thinking skills and an intrinsic desire to understand.
